Compact Pushbutton Intercom Panel
The Clear-Com VI-PNLB-12P is a professional 1RU rackmount intercom keypanel designed for broadcast studios, live production environments, and control rooms. It features 12 programmable pushbutton keysets that allow operators to quickly communicate with channels, users, or system functions.
Each keyset includes a high-brightness 10-character color display, a visual volume indicator, and a tally light that clearly shows the status of communication channels.
Efficient Communication Control
The panel allows communication with individual users, groups, IFB channels, and system roles. Pushbutton keysets provide quick access to talk and listen functions, allowing operators to manage communications efficiently during live operations.
Advanced system capabilities such as key stacking, shift pages, and separate talk and listen assignments help simplify complex communication workflows.
Flexible Connectivity Options
The Clear-Com VI-PNLB-12P supports several connection types to integrate with professional intercom infrastructures.
The panel can connect through LAN network ports for AES67 capable network communication or through analog connections directly to Eclipse MVX interface cards. These options allow flexible deployment in both local and distributed communication networks.
Integrated Audio and Control Interfaces
The rear panel includes multiple audio and control interfaces that allow the connection of headsets, microphones, and external devices.
Available connections include headset ports, gooseneck microphone input, auxiliary line-level audio inputs and outputs, GPIO logic interfaces, and expansion panel connectivity for larger intercom systems.
Advanced Features with Eclipse Systems
When used with an Eclipse Digital Matrix system, the panel supports additional advanced features including key stacking, expansion panel support, dynamic routing, and remote IFB control.
The integrated DSP mixer provides audio routing, filtering, and dynamics processing to ensure reliable and clear communication during critical operations.
